Position Summary:


The Manager, Global Supply Chain Master Data Operations maintains and supports Global Master Data processes as related to the Supply Chain, specific to transportation management (Rates, Lanes, and Freight Settlement).

This role is integral to the company's data management process and responsible for determining how to meet new and changing business needs for the company’s digital journey through master data.

The Global Master Data Operations role intent is to act as a trusted adviser to CPS (Concentrate Plants) regarding Supply Chain Master Data and drive cross-functional alignment to deliver company Data objectives; to support master data initiatives for global deployment projects; adherence to Enterprise Data Governance through data management policies, procedures, stewardship awareness; and implement global improvements supporting master data and quality.

It will align with the applicable supply chain transformation initiatives and cross-functional teams in order to ensure accurate and appropriate master data creation and maintenance. 

What You’ll Do for Us:

  • Manage the life cycle of assigned supply chain master data
  • Transportation Management System (TMS) knowledge and use
  • TMS System Maintenance: Responsible for all aspects of updating TMS related to management of over 3K transportation lane, rate, and capacity limits
  • Annual & Monthly Mini Bid Implementation:  responsible for implementing all bids and fuel charge fluctuations into TMS
  • Freight Settlement issue resolution related to master data; works with CPS and Global Logistics Services to research and reconcile carrier billing issues
  • Multi-modal transportation knowledge; Ocean, rail, and over-the-road truckload
  • Manage SAP security requests for SAP P07, SAP MDM and conduct periodic reviews.
  • Liaise with TCCC, GLS and CPS to resolve system issues and be the primary point of contact for TMS functional and system issues
  • Suggest key process and performance improvement opportunities within TMS identified during the course of support
